## Tuning sqlsift

sqlsift ships with sane defaults, but you can crank the strictness for security-sensitive schemas. The injection-pattern checks are the ones you'll care about most — they flag string concatenation in WHERE clauses and unparameterised literals. False positives happen, so tune thresholds per repo rather than globally. The defaults we ship are shown below.

tuning table, yajog-yahof:
BUDGETS = {
    "lamvan": 303,
    "wenox": 460,
    "fenvan": 525,
}

☐ Show the new starter the bike cage behind Larkfield House and walk them through the parking gate sequence: pull up close to the sensor, wait for the amber light, then present the pass. Confirm they know the out-of-hours exit route via Gate B. The gate keypad accepts the code below.

door code, yagap-bahof: bdg-O-05

Welcome aboard. Your first task touches the websocket reconnect bug in Relaygate: clients occasionally drop after idle timeouts and fail to resubscribe. Reproduce it locally with the chaos proxy before changing anything, and document your findings in the incident log. To push your fix branch to the staging remote, use the deploy key below.

signing key of bagap-yawep = bky13_TbfT6ZMUoGJo2

# Fernhollow password reset revamp — plugin author notes.
# The reset flow now issues one-time tokens through the Gatewren service
# instead of emailing raw links. Plugins that hook into reset events must
# validate tokens via the new verify endpoint; legacy hooks are removed.
# Configure your plugin sandbox exactly as below, in order, since Gatewren
# reads this file top-down. The token-signing credential comes next, on
# the line immediately following this comment block.

sealed setting: RELAY_SECRET29=2d90f50448baa6c07af134de232e6